Paper Filing
Paper filing has been with us for a while now and is the traditional way of preparing taxes. Actually, a high number of people are still counting on the pen and paper method when handling financial information. You should, however, keep in mind this method of filing tax returns takes longer for the IRS to process. For this reason, returns may be slower to arrive.
Tax Preparation Software
Income tax calculator is the most preferred DIY way of filing your tax returns. Most tax preparations software is designed to make filing easier and will make it easy for you to identify any available tax deductions and credits you would otherwise have missed.
